Living it up on the Left Coast? You're in luck! Los Angeles is a mere 236 miles away from Vegas, which translates to a quick 1-hour, 10-minute flight. That's practically a nap with complimentary peanuts!

Central US Citizen? Buckle Up for a Bit More

Calling Texas or the Midwest home? Vegas is a bit further out, but not enough to make you cry into your cowboy hat. From Dallas, you're looking at around 1,050 miles and 3 hours in the air. Think of it as extra time to perfect your poker face.

East Coast Escapades? Vegas, Here We Come (Eventually)

Oof, East Coasters. You guys got the short end of the stick this time. From New York City, you're looking at a whopping 2,400-mile journey, translating to roughly 5 hours of plane time. But hey, more time to stock up on in-flight movies and questionable airplane snacks!
